Eco-Friendly Ways To Dispose Of Anti-Freeze Bottles Safely And Responsibly

how to get rid of anti freeze bottles

Disposing of antifreeze bottles properly is crucial to prevent environmental harm and health risks, as antifreeze contains toxic chemicals like ethylene glycol. To safely get rid of these bottles, start by checking local regulations, as many areas have specific guidelines for hazardous waste disposal. Never pour antifreeze down drains or into the environment, as it can contaminate water sources and harm wildlife. Instead, empty the bottles completely, rinse them with water to remove residue, and recycle the plastic containers if possible. The used antifreeze itself should be taken to a designated hazardous waste collection site or an auto parts store that accepts it for recycling. Always handle antifreeze with care, wearing gloves and ensuring proper ventilation to avoid exposure.

Recycling centers for anti-freeze bottles

Anti-freeze bottles, typically made of high-density polyethylene (HDPE), are recyclable, but their proper disposal requires careful handling due to the hazardous nature of their contents. Recycling centers equipped to process these bottles play a critical role in preventing environmental contamination and promoting sustainability. Unlike regular plastic recycling, anti-freeze bottles must be emptied and rinsed thoroughly to remove residual chemicals before being accepted by most facilities. This ensures the safety of recycling workers and prevents cross-contamination with other materials.

Locating a recycling center that accepts anti-freeze bottles begins with checking local waste management guidelines or contacting municipal recycling programs. Many regions have designated drop-off points or collection events for hazardous materials, including anti-freeze containers. Websites like Earth911 or RecycleNation offer searchable databases to find nearby facilities. Some auto parts stores, such as AutoZone or O’Reilly Auto Parts, also participate in recycling programs, accepting empty anti-freeze bottles as part of their commitment to environmental stewardship.

When preparing anti-freeze bottles for recycling, follow specific steps to ensure acceptance. First, pour any remaining anti-freeze into a vehicle’s cooling system or store it in a sealed, labeled container for future use. Next, rinse the bottle with water to remove residue, as even small amounts of anti-freeze can contaminate recycling batches. Remove the cap, as it may be made of a different plastic type, and dispose of it according to local guidelines. Finally, confirm with the recycling center whether they require bottles to be crushed or left intact.

Proper disposal methods to prevent environmental harm

Antifreeze, primarily composed of ethylene glycol, is toxic to humans, pets, and wildlife. Improper disposal of antifreeze bottles or their contents can contaminate soil and water sources, posing significant environmental risks. Even small amounts—as little as a tablespoon—can be lethal to animals. To mitigate harm, prioritize containment and responsible disposal over convenience.

Step-by-Step Disposal Method: Begin by sealing the antifreeze bottle tightly in its original container. If the bottle is damaged, transfer the liquid to a puncture-resistant, leakproof container labeled "Antifreeze—Hazardous." Never pour antifreeze down drains, toilets, or storm sewers, as it can infiltrate groundwater. Instead, locate a hazardous waste collection facility or automotive shop that accepts antifreeze for recycling. Many regions offer designated drop-off days or permanent collection sites. Call ahead to confirm acceptance policies and hours.

Recycling vs. Disposal: Used antifreeze can often be recycled through a process that removes contaminants and restores the glycol for reuse. This reduces demand for new antifreeze production, conserving resources. If recycling isn’t an option, hazardous waste facilities neutralize the toxic components before disposal. Avoid mixing antifreeze with other chemicals, as this complicates treatment and increases environmental risk.

Preventative Measures: To minimize future waste, consider switching to propylene glycol-based antifreeze, which is less toxic and biodegradable. Always store antifreeze in clearly labeled, childproof containers, and clean up spills immediately using absorbent materials like kitty litter or sand. Dispose of these materials at a hazardous waste facility to prevent contamination.

Reusing anti-freeze bottles for DIY projects

Anti-freeze bottles, often discarded after use, can be transformed into versatile tools for DIY enthusiasts. Their durable plastic construction and secure caps make them ideal for repurposing, reducing waste, and saving money. Before reusing, ensure the bottles are thoroughly cleaned with soap and water to remove any residual chemicals, and consider labeling them clearly to avoid confusion with their original contents.

One creative application is using anti-freeze bottles as custom storage containers. Their sturdy design makes them perfect for organizing small items like screws, nails, or craft supplies. For added convenience, cut the bottle in half horizontally; the top half can serve as a funnel, while the bottom half becomes a storage bin. This dual-purpose solution maximizes utility and minimizes clutter in your workspace.

For outdoor enthusiasts, anti-freeze bottles can be repurposed into portable water carriers or makeshift watering cans. Drill small holes in the cap for controlled water flow, or remove the cap entirely for quicker dispensing. These bottles are also excellent for creating DIY bird feeders. Simply attach a perch and fill the bottle with seeds, ensuring the openings are large enough for birds to access the food but small enough to prevent spillage.

Another innovative use is in gardening. Cut the bottom of the bottle to create a mini greenhouse for seedlings. Place the bottle over young plants to protect them from frost or pests, providing a controlled environment for growth. Alternatively, use the bottles as planters by cutting them in half and filling them with soil. Their translucent nature allows sunlight to reach the roots, promoting healthy plant development.

While repurposing anti-freeze bottles is eco-friendly, safety should always be a priority. Avoid using these bottles for food or beverage storage, as traces of chemicals may remain despite thorough cleaning. Additionally, when cutting or drilling the bottles, wear protective gloves and eyewear to prevent injuries. Safe handling and storage before disposal

Antifreeze, a toxic substance, demands careful handling and storage before disposal to prevent harm to humans, pets, and the environment. Its sweet taste attracts animals and children, making spills or leaks particularly dangerous. Always wear gloves and safety goggles when handling antifreeze bottles, even if they appear sealed, to avoid skin and eye irritation. Store bottles upright in their original containers, tightly sealed, and out of reach in a cool, dry area away from food, beverages, and living spaces.

Consider the storage location’s temperature and ventilation. Antifreeze should be kept in an area where temperatures remain stable, ideally between 40°F and 90°F, to prevent container degradation or leakage. Avoid storing it near open flames, heaters, or direct sunlight, as antifreeze is flammable and can release toxic fumes when heated. If storing in a garage or workshop, ensure the area is well-ventilated to disperse any accidental vapors. For households with children or pets, a locked cabinet or high shelf is essential to prevent accidental ingestion.

Before disposal, inspect antifreeze bottles for cracks, leaks, or corrosion. Transfer any leaking or damaged containers to a secondary, leak-proof vessel, such as a heavy-duty plastic bag or sealed bucket, to contain spills. Label the secondary container clearly with “Antifreeze – Toxic” to avoid confusion. If a spill occurs, clean it immediately using absorbent materials like kitty litter or commercial spill kits, and dispose of the contaminated material as hazardous waste. Never pour antifreeze down drains, toilets, or into the ground, as it can contaminate water sources.
